    Job Responsibilities

    With our Agency's mission to support the recovery of people with mental illnesses, we provide a complete array of medical and support services for children, adults, and families throughout South Carolina.

    This position is located at the Department of Mental Health, within Inpatient Services, 7901 Farrow Road Columbia, SC 29203.

    As the Food Service Spec III (Shipping/Receiving/Transportation), working under the Shipping/Receiving/Transportation Area Manager and/or Operations Manager, you will provide supervision to assigned staff in the Shipping, Receiving, and Dish Room areas in compliance with department, local, state, and federal guidelines.

    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
    • Operates as the back-up driver for contractual operations, as needed, to various sites for receiving and making deliveries for food and supply items. As a driver, you will adhere to all rules, such as, but not limited to, checking the maintenance of vehicle before leaving in the morning, cleaning truck as needed, clean/sanitize truck between deliveries, plug in truck when not in use, report mechanical problems to supervisor, delivers according to schedule, do not transport dirty trays with clean trays and receives list of duties from supervisor between deliveries.
    • Senior Lead of other staff in conducting physical inventory and fills requisitions for departmental food and supplies. Receives, counts, and verifies food and supply deliveries against invoices.
    • Senior Lead of other staff in receiving food and supplies, storing in appropriate location using FIFO principle and maintaining cleanliness and organization of all cold and dry areas.
    • Maintains records for inventories, quality control, quality assurance, sanitation check list, temperature, charts, and all other records necessary for the operation of the shipping/receiving/transport area. Maintains HACCP (Hazard Analysis Critical Control Point) standards compliance in all work areas. Checks and maintains truck logs for all Nutrition Services vehicles.
    • Trains new staff.
    • Provides services in a pleasant, helpful and positive manner to demonstrate good customer service.
    • Adheres to patients' privacy and "Bill of Rights" standard requirements while performing duties.
    Minimum and Additional Requirements

    There are no minimum training and experience requirements for this class. Must obtain ServSafe certification within three (3) months of hire. Must have and maintain a valid South Carolin driver's license.

    Additional Comments

    The selected candidate must maintain a valid driver's license. Physical requirements include the ability to manually lift 50 pounds, push 100 pounds, walk or stand for extended periods of time. Must be able to bend, stoop, reach, pull, push, climb and stairs. May encounter temperatures ranging from -10 degrees F to 400 degrees F around equipment. This is an essential position in an emergency.
